running ATF, Hyd fluid, Motor oil
I've been running 20% used ATF, Motor Oil, and now free used ISO 32 hydraulic oil from work, two years. Same tank. I have a 10 micron Goldenrod plastic bowl filter on the 240D instead of the tiny primary filter, running metal 8mm tubes over to the filter mounted off the right front shock mount. These are available from farm supply stores, also Northern Tool Equipment mail order. I'm catching a lot of water in the bowl even when I don't run waste (dead of winter), and it is convenient to drain it out with the valve on the bottom of the plastic bowl, instead of spinning off a metal filter. I got disgusted with the tiny primary filter when my car stalled out 4 times on the way to and from Colorado, requiring filter change. I suspect the stock secondary filter is 5 micron, but of course I don't know. I carry a boat gasoline primer bulb and hose to prime the filter when I change it. It saved me a tow once when I got too much water in the filter, I was trying to burn of the "residue" of Reformulated gas left in the tank of my 59 ford after it sat for a year, the "gas" turned out to be mostly water with some kind of stinky RFG additive in it. It froze hard in December. RFG is why I bought the diesel, it won't run the '59 after it sits for 3 months or so.
